Monterey Approves To Name I-40 Exit 301 Overpass

Monterey Aldermen approved a resolution to name the I-40 overpass at exit 301 the CS3 Zachary T. Schonborn Memorial Bridge. Schonborn joined the Navy after graduating from Monterey High School in 2020. He was killed in a hit-and-run motorcycle accident just over a year ago. Aldermen Table Decision To Support Annexation Changes

Monterey Aldermen tabled a decision to ask the Legislature to consider changes to the annexation process. The proposal would allow annexation if two-thirds of the property owners in the proposed area provided written consent without holding a referendum. Monterey Aldermen Approve Codes Director Position

Monterey Aldermen approved adding a codes director position Monday night, ending several years without one. Mayor Alex Garcia said the proposed salary would be a $15,000 annual salary plus 50 percent of the permit fees the position collects. Monterey Police Request To Use Former Sewer Plant

The Monterey Police Department wants to use the Old Sewer Plant on Woodcliff Drive as an additional police facility. Sergeant Larry Bates said the plant sits close to the department’s firing range. Monterey Switching Health Insurance Brokers, For Savings

Monterey Aldermen approved switching health insurance brokers during a special-called meeting Monday.
